YouTube's discontinuation of support for Android 7.1.1 marks the end of an era for devices from 2016 and earlier. Users who wish to continue accessing the platform on these older smartphones and tablets must adopt alternative solutions. The browser-based approach through m.youtube.com offers the simplest and most accessible path forward, requiring no technical expertise and functioning on any device with a web browser. For users seeking additional features like background playback and ad-free viewing, NewPipe provides an excellent third-party alternative. Technically proficient users can explore ReVanced patching to continue using a modified version of the official app.

: Google stopped issuing security updates for Android 7.1 in September 2021. Crucially, legacy OS builds struggle with modern web certificates (like Let's Encrypt), causing connection drops and secure handshake failures when contacting Google servers. A: NewPipe is open-source and has been audited by security researchers, making it generally safe. ReVanced is also open-source, though it requires modifying the official YouTube app, which technically violates Google's terms of service. Neither solution has been reported to contain malware when downloaded from official sources (newpipe.net for NewPipe and github.com for ReVanced).
